Is Microblading Safe in Summer? Everything You Need to Know

Microblading is one of the most popular beauty treatments for achieving fuller, natural-looking eyebrows. Many people love getting microblading before vacations or during summer because it reduces the need for daily eyebrow makeup. However, a common concern is whether microblading is safe during hot and humid weather.

The answer is yes — microblading is safe in summer if you follow proper aftercare instructions. While heat, sweat, and sun exposure can affect healing, taking the right precautions helps your brows heal beautifully and maintain long-lasting pigment.

What Is Microblading?

Microblading is a semi-permanent cosmetic procedure that uses a handheld tool with fine needles to create hair-like strokes in the eyebrow area. Pigment is deposited into the upper layers of the skin to enhance eyebrow shape and fullness.

Results usually last between 12–18 months depending on skin type, lifestyle, and aftercare.

Is Summer a Good Time for Microblading?

Yes, summer can actually be a convenient time for microblading because you can enjoy smudge-free brows without worrying about makeup melting in the heat.

However, summer conditions require extra care because:

  • Sweat may affect pigment retention
  • Sun exposure can fade pigment faster
  • Swimming pools and beaches may irritate healing skin
  • Humidity increases skin oiliness

If you can follow aftercare properly, microblading during summer is completely safe.

Why Summer Can Affect Microblading Healing

Excessive Sweating

Sweat can interfere with the healing process during the first few days after treatment. Too much moisture may prevent pigment from settling evenly into the skin.

Activities to Avoid

  • Heavy gym workouts
  • Running outdoors
  • Sauna sessions
  • Hot yoga

Avoid excessive sweating for at least 7–10 days after your appointment.

Sun Exposure

Direct sunlight is one of the biggest reasons microblading pigment fades quickly.

UV Rays and Pigment Fading

UV rays break down pigment and may cause discoloration. Protecting your brows from sunlight is essential during healing.

The National Health Portal of India recommends limiting excessive sun exposure to protect sensitive skin and prevent damage.

Is Swimming Safe After Microblading?

No, swimming should be avoided until your brows fully heal.

Why Pools and Beaches Are Risky

Chlorine Irritation

Pool chemicals may irritate healing skin and affect color retention.

Saltwater Dryness

Sea water can dry out the brow area and slow healing.

Infection Risk

Public water may contain bacteria that can cause irritation or infection.

Essential Summer Aftercare Tips

Proper aftercare is the key to safe and successful microblading during summer.

Keep Brows Dry

Avoid soaking your brows in water while showering or washing your face.

Avoid Touching the Area

Touching your brows with dirty hands may introduce bacteria and increase irritation.

Use Recommended Ointment

Apply aftercare products exactly as instructed by your technician.

Stay Out of Direct Sunlight

Wear hats and sunglasses when outdoors to protect your brows.

Do Not Pick Scabs

Light flaking and scabbing are normal during healing. Picking at them can remove pigment and cause uneven results.

Who Should Avoid Summer Microblading?

You may want to postpone microblading if:

  • You swim frequently
  • Your job requires long hours outdoors
  • You cannot avoid sweating
  • You are planning beach vacations immediately after treatment

Otherwise, most people can safely get microblading in summer with proper care.

How Long Does Healing Take?

Microblading typically heals within 4–6 weeks.

Healing Stages

Week 1

Brows appear darker and slightly sensitive.

Week 2

Flaking and mild scabbing begin.

Week 3–4

Pigment softens and settles naturally.

Week 6

Final healed results become visible.
